User Information Setting Items
Item Explanation
User ID Enter the user ID to use authentication between 1 and 83 bytes in Unicode.
Since the User ID is not case sensitive, you can login using upper or lower case
letters.
User name Display Enter the user name displayed on the printer's control panel within 32 characters
in Unicode. You can leave this blank.
Password Enter the password to use authentication within 32 characters in ASCII. The
password is case sensitive.
Leave this blank if you select User ID for How to Authenticate User.
Authentication Card ID Set the reading result of ID card. When you permit the Allow users to register
authentication cards for Authentication Settings, the result registered by users
is
reected.
Enter within 116 characters in ASCII. You can leave this blank.
ID Number It is displayed when Card or ID Number or ID Number is selected on Epson
Open Platform tab > Authentication Settings > How to Authenticate User.
Enter the number between 4 and 8 digits depending on the digits set on Epson
Open Platform tab > Authentication Settings > The Minimum Digit Number
of ID Number.
Auto Generate It is displayed when Card or ID Number or ID Number is selected on Epson
Open Platform tab > Authentication Settings > How to Authenticate User.
Click to generate the ID number automatically that the digit is same as the The
Minimum Digit Number of ID Number you set.
Department Enter the department name arbitrary to distinguish the users.
You can leave this blank.
Email Address Set the email address for the users. This is used as the destination of Scan to My
Email.
You can leave this blank.
Restrictions You can restrict functions for each user. Select the functions you want to allow in
Select the check box to enable or disable each function.
Color Printing Restriction You can restrict color printing for each user. Select the type of printing you want
to allow from the drop-down menu.
Auto release jobs upon device login Sets whether or not to start printing automatically when a user logs in to the
printer.
Presets You can specify which presets can be used by specic users.
